Hi, Harry-

I'm a longtime lurker but I've come across a couple of little developments that may interest you...

1. I spoke at length with a modelbuilder working for Stan Winston Studios while I was at the Pasadena Mad Model Party (a garage model kit convention). The gentleman was working on study models and macquets for "A.I.", mainly robots and futuristic machinery. Said gentleman described the robots as being very thin and spindley, sort of a cross between an Episode One battle droid and a human skeleton with some Syd Mead-like sensibilities to it.

2. I've read recently of your upcoming trip to ComiCon and I've also read of your enthusiasm for "Robinson Crusoe on Mars". Well, Paul Mantee and (perhaps- it's not yet confirmed) Vic Lundin are planning on attending ComiCon. They should have a booth and will be autographing photos and lobby cards from that Martian classic. Look for them, I'm sure that they would love to talk to you. Vic might be a bit difficult to recognize if you haven't seen him recently but Paul Mantee still looks as good as ever, just with grey, somewhat thinning hair.
